ubuntu

Ubuntu Kafka日志级别设置指南

小樊
47
2025-08-28 13:10:44
栏目: 智能运维

在Ubuntu上设置Kafka日志级别,需修改配置文件并重启服务,具体步骤如下:

  1. 找到配置文件
    Kafka配置文件通常位于安装目录的config文件夹中,常见路径为/opt/kafka/config/log4j.properties/etc/kafka/log4j.properties

  2. 编辑配置文件
    使用文本编辑器(如nanovim)打开文件,修改以下参数:

    • 根日志级别:修改log4j.rootLogger,可选级别为TRACEDEBUGINFOWARNERRORFATALOFF(优先级从低到高)。例如:
      log4j.rootLogger=INFO, stdout(设置根日志为INFO级别,输出到控制台)。
    • 组件日志级别:可单独设置Kafka组件(如消费者、生产者)的日志级别,格式为log4j.logger.组件名=级别。例如:
      log4j.logger.kafka.consumer=DEBUG(设置消费者日志为DEBUG级别)。
  3. 保存并重启服务
    保存文件后,重启Kafka使配置生效:

    sudo systemctl restart kafka  
    

    若使用旧版本Kafka,可尝试:

    sudo service kafka restart  
    
  4. 验证日志输出
    查看日志文件(通常位于/opt/kafka/logs//var/log/kafka/),确认日志级别已生效。例如:

    tail -f /opt/kafka/logs/server.log  
    

注意

0
看了该问题的人还看了